Met. Dept. warns of thundershowers accompanied by severe lightning

Thundershowers accompanied by severe lightning are likely to occur at several places in Uva, Central, Sabaragamuwa, North-central and North-western provinces and in Ampara, Mannar and Vavuniya districts.

Issuing an advisory, the Department of Meteorology said fairly heavy showers above 100 mm are expected in some places in the above areas.

There may be temporary localized strong winds during thundershowers.

The Meteorology Department requests the public to take adequate precautions to minimize damages caused by lightning activity.
